2.1.11. show Chapter 2. Command Reference context, just type show. Show a table of all objects of a type by specifying a type or a category. Use the -errors or -changes flags to show what objects have been changed or have errors in the configuration. When showing a table of all objects of a certain type, the status of each object since the last time the configuration was committed is indicated by a flag. The flags used are: - The object is deleted. o The object is disabled. ! The object has errors. + The object is newly created. * The object is modified. Additional flags: D The object has dynamic properties which are updated by the system. When listing categories and object types, categories are indicated by [] and types where objects may be contexts by /. Example 2.6. Show objects Show the properties of an individual object: gw-world:/> show Address IP4Address example_ip gw-world:/main> show Route 1 gw-world:/> show Client DynDnsClientDyndnsOrg Show a table of all objects of a type and a selection of their properties as well as their status: gw-world:/> show Address IP4Address gw-world:/> show IP4Address Show a table of all objects for each type in a category: gw-world:/> show Address Show objects with changes and errors: gw-world:/> show -changes gw-world:/> show -errors Show what objects use (refer to) a certain object: gw-world:/> show Address IP4Address example_ip -references Usage show Show the types and categories available in the current context. show [] [ []] [-disabled] [-references] Show an object or list a type or category. show -errors [-verbose] Show all errors. show -changes 27
